Obviously he can get baited, but from what I’ve known and seen a lot of Vega players will dive every wakeup until stopped. (the old if it works, why change it ST mindset) Forcing them to try to bait your shoryu actually makes a match of it, so stuffing a dive asap is pretty important.
I know Ryu’s jhk (angled or neutral) is good at stopping his off the wall stuff, jmp works as well. As for the ground game, I can’t think of much that Vega can’t stuff atleast from the normal fireballing/usual Ryu range. Since he can hop your FBs so easily, and clean counter/trade when he doesn’t hop… well, I’d fight him up close.
I’m not a serious shoto player, I play Bison and OG Sagat, but I do know how to beat them. Hopping over the fireballs (straight up) and countering them clean when you predict adds up. That’s how Vega is going to win the match ultimately, not necessarily the dive. I have the hardest time against a shoto when he’s coming at me, taking away the range of my (Bison) standing MK/HK and uppercutting my tricks. I have the easiest time when I can kick him every time he tries to FB me from midscreen, use my tricks safely, and dictate the match.
Take the initiative and beat that ass. Vega doesn’t have that big of combos, and staying at a fireballing range only plays into his gameplan.
